**Capacity note — Grayfen static-analysis baseline (Q3).** The baseline file for the Hollowpine scanner now tracks 41k suppressed findings and is loaded fully into memory by every CI worker. Growth is roughly 6% per month, driven mostly by the Ostrel monolith. For security review: entries older than the expiry window are re-surfaced as live findings, so the expiry constant directly controls how long a suppressed vulnerability can hide. Parse time and memory caps also bound worker sizing. The current tuning constants are listed below.

constants for tageg-kagag:
QUOTAS = {
    "kelax": 495,
    "istath": 366,
    "tammir": 108,
    "novdor": 730,
    "casax": 816,
    "quenael": 874,
    "pelius": 403,
}

## Annual Billing Move (Managers Only)

Quick heads-up, folks: from Q3 we're shifting Brightvale customers to annual billing by default. Monthly stays available but gets a small surcharge. Finance reckons this smooths our cash flow nicely and cuts churn admin for the Delford team. Please brief your leads before the town hall, not after. One more thing before you scroll on — keep the next bit strictly to yourselves.

internal memo for fajog-yagaf: Gross margin on Ulaael came in at 20 percent against a plan of 10 percent. Only 9 of the 80 pilot accounts renewed Ulaael, so a churn review is set for July 1.

Subject: Formula sandboxing — what you need to know on-call

Hi Priya,

Welcome to the Lanternworks rotation. The biggest risk area is user-supplied formulas in Gridforge: they run inside the Hollowbox sandbox, and any escape from it pages on-call immediately. Do not restart the sandbox pool without first draining active evaluations, or you'll corrupt in-flight spreadsheets. The runbook covers timeout tuning, denylist updates, and the escalation path to the Calcline team. Before your first shift, please read the sandbox runbook here.

dashboard of yafog-fajof = https://jira.tolvaqsys.internal/pages/pages/projects/49fe21c4